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 22.03.2017, 15:41   #1
JekJek778
Новичок
Джуниор
 
Регистрация: 22.03.2017
Сообщений: 3
По умолчанию JavaScript для фотошопа, работа с файлами.

Доброго времени суток. У меня стоит простая и специфическая задача: написать примитив для фотошопа в CS6Plugin ExtendScript Toolkit. Всю фотошопню часть опустим, а нужно на ЯваСкрипте: Цикл, который пройдет все файлы в папке, заранее заданной константой, и через alert выдаст все символы из имени каждого файла, которые находятся после "_" (подчеркивание). То есть 5 файлов, 5 алертов. Заранее спасибо.
JekJek778 вне форума Ответить с цитированием
Старый 22.03.2017, 15:52   #2
Alex11223
Старожил
 
Аватар для Alex11223
 
Регистрация: 12.01.2011
Сообщений: 19,500
По умолчанию

За что спасибо? Это ж форум, а не решатель задач )
Тем более что это сложно сделать без знания этого тулкита, в самом JS нет никаких файлов.
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ом.
Alex11223 вне форума Ответить с цитированием
Старый 22.03.2017, 19:53   #3
JekJek778
Новичок
Джуниор
 
Регистрация: 22.03.2017
Сообщений: 3
По умолчанию

Разобрался. Закрывайте
JekJek778 вне форума Ответить с цитированием
Старый 22.03.2017, 19:59   #4
Alex11223
Старожил
 
Аватар для Alex11223
 
Регистрация: 12.01.2011
Сообщений: 19,500
По умолчанию

Так и как разобрались?
Вдруг кто-то еще с этим столкнется )
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ом.
Alex11223 вне форума Ответить с цитированием
Старый 22.03.2017, 22:07   #5
JekJek778
Новичок
Джуниор
 
Регистрация: 22.03.2017
Сообщений: 3
По умолчанию

Код:
myFolder = Folder ('c:/Test');  //указываем папку из которой нужно перебрать

myArray = myFolder.getFiles ();   //создается массив из ссылок к файлам
var n = myArray.length;  //длина массива, то есть количество файлов
var i = 0;
for (i = 0; i<n; i++)         //проходим по всем файлам по-очереди
{   
    myFile = myArray[i];  //привязываем ссылку из массива к файловой переменной, в теле делаем что хотим с файлом.
}
Дальше обращение к имени идет myFile.name, возвращает строку вида "имя.расширение". В остальном дефолтный яваскрипт по работе со строкой.

Последний раз редактировалось Alex11223; 22.03.2017 в 22:11.
JekJek778 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Программы для фото, и фотошопа. Татьяна18 Моделирование, изометрия, photoshop, 3d редакторы 1 19.06.2016 22:08
Работа с файлами: запись, добавление, чтение (найти ошибку в коде) / C для начинающих Надо создать программу для работы с файлами Konlor Общие вопросы C/C++ 2 18.05.2014 12:37
Работа для Программистов JavaScript!!! arevik JavaScript, Ajax 10 24.04.2013 08:56
Работа для JavaScript программистов i-v-i JavaScript, Ajax 0 27.01.2011 17:19
фото для фотошопа stenl1 Свободное общение 5 07.02.2010 22:21